Having children emphasizes the importance of making and caring for money, since you are responsible for other people and their standard of living. The habits that may have worked when you were alone no longer will. Households made up if one or two parents will be able to benefit from the following suggestions.
Take advantage of generic brands whenever possible. They are often the same thing sold by name brand companies. Many children, though, are convinced that the only types of cereal they like are those name brands theyve gotten acquainted with, so help them get accustomed to their generic counterparts slowly. Using a separate container instead of the cereals original packaging to store it could help kids make the switch without even noticing.
Both name brand and generic toiletries can be found at dollar stores for discounted prices. These could include shampoo, detergent, soap, and other common home cleaning supplies. Shopping at such stores before going straight to the grocery store can help save money. Using coupons at the grocery store will be of even more assistance.
Stop using expensive professional cleaning services in favor of doing you cleaning at home instead. For example, using Dryel brand dryer sheets works almost exactly like professional dry cleaning, but is much more cost effective and can be done in a normal home dryer.
Purchase a used car. We all want a new car, don't we? The truth is cars depreciate as soon as they leave the dealer's lot. Purchasing an inspected used car from a reputable dealer saves money on car payments. Check to see that the car has a good service record and that it has not been damaged in any way before you agree to buy.
Find unexpected places to make your clothing purchases. These could be made up of yard sales, thrift stores, consignment shops, and flea markets. You will have to spend more time hunting down real quality garments at these places, but the price you get will be well worth the extra effort you will have put forth. In this way, the entire family can dress great at a great price.
Deduct money for savings directly from your paycheck. We all mean to put a little something away each pay period but we can be forgetful. If you have direct deposit, make provision for a certain amount of money to be automatically sent to your savings account as soon as you get paid. This can still be the arrangement if you have to deposit your paycheck every two weeks. Set up a transfer with the bank to move that money to the savings account each time you deposit your paycheck.
Saving money requires determination and effort. Sadly, it is never easy. Though taking out some time to get a hold of the familys financial situation is not easy or pleasant, the entire family (including the kids) is well worth it.
